RPC Return Structure
call foo(x,y)
proc foo(a,b)
call foo(x,y)
proc foo(a,b)
begin foo...
end foo
client
program
client
stub
RPC
runtime
RPC
runtime
server
stub
server
program
send
client continues
stub unpacks
msg, returns
to caller
runtime
receives msg,
calls stub
server proc
returns
stub builds
result msg
with output
args
runtime
responds
to original
msg
return
msg received
return
send msg
Previous slide
Next slide
Back to first slide
View graphic version